Description

Embark on a breathtaking journey through time to discover the fascinating history of our planet. From the birth of the first ocean to the rise of life, from fiery volcanic eruptions to icy glacial ages, this picture book brings Earth's 4.5-billion-year story to life in a way that's vivid, accessible and awe-inspiring. Young readers will meet microscopic creatures, towering dinosaurs and witness the dramatic transformations that shaped the world we know today.

A celebration of science, nature and imagination, this book invites children to explore the wonders of Earth's past - and understand the challenges it overcame to become our home. Stunning, imaginative illustrations vividly recreate prehistoric landscapes and creatures, transporting readers back in time with breathtaking detail.
